Journalist Day in Ukraine (06/06)

Every year on June 6, Ukraine celebrates Journalist Day (Ukrainian). Magazine Day). This professional holiday for media workers was established by Decree of the President of Ukraine № 251/94 of May 25, 1994 in honor of the admission of the Union of Journalists of Ukraine in 1992 to the International Federation of Journalists.

The Union of Journalists of Ukraine was created on April 23, 1959 and during the era of the USSR was a branch of the Union of Journalists of the USSR. After the collapse of the Soviet Union and Ukraine gained independence, the Union of Journalists of Ukraine began to be called the National Union of Journalists of Ukraine (National Spilka of Ukrainian Journalists).

Journalist's Day – is not only a professional holiday for media workers – journalists, correspondents and reporters. This, one might say, is a national holiday, because it is difficult to imagine modern society without information, without means of transmitting it, without a professional view of events and facts of life.

Free press and media pluralism – indicator of a free, pluralistic and open society.

Unfortunately, in recent years, an alarming situation has developed in Ukraine when the ability of journalists to do their work is limited by the authorities, thereby undermining the right of society to receive reliable information.
